what is the slope of a line that contains the points (13,-2) and (3,-2)

Respuesta :

nalapride1205
nalapride1205 nalapride1205
  • 21-01-2019

Answer:

0

Step-by-step explanation:

since both corrdinate points have -2 as a y value but two different x values, the slope is 0
